Komipharm, 20,353 Foreign Investors Net Buy... Stock Price Up 1.32%
As of 2:31 PM on the 15th, Komipharm is trading at 11,500 KRW, up 1.32% from the previous day. This is a 9.45% decrease compared to January 14. Komipharm is known as a manufacturer of veterinary vaccines and disinfectants.
Today, foreigners are tentatively recorded as net buyers of 20,353 shares. Over the past five days, individual investors have been net buyers of 18,360 shares, while foreigners and institutions have been net buyers of 14,964 shares and net sellers of 36,468 shares, respectively.
